Learned counsel for the petitioners submits that he is not pressing the application on behalf of the petitioner no. 4 as he has been taken into custody. Accordingly, the application on his behalf stands dismissed as withdrawn.
The petitioners apprehend arrest in Chhauradano P.S. Case No. 125 of 2015 dated 09.07.2015 instituted under Sections 147/148/149/323/324/354/307/379/504/506 of the Indian Penal Code and 27 of the Arms Act.
The allegation against the petitioners and three others is of assault but against them it is general and omnibus and against petitioners no. 3 and 6 the further allegation is of tearing the clothes of a woman and against petitioners no. 8 and 9 of tearing the cloth of Birendra Rai and against petitioner no. 7 of dragging the victim lady.
Learned counsel for the petitioners submits that the present case is false and lodged after three days of lodging Chhauradano P.S. Case No. 123 of 2015 by the petitioner no. 1 against the informant and others under Sections 147/148/149/323/ 324/325/307/379/504/506 of the Indian Penal Code. Learned counsel submits that the parties are agnates and there is land dispute for which partition suit is pending. It is further submitted
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.47867 of 2015 (2) dt.06-11-2015 3/3 that the injuries are simple in nature and the petitioners have no criminal antecedent.
Learned A.P.P. opposes the prayer for anticipatory bail. However, he is not in a position to controvert the submissions of learned counsel for the petitioners.
Considering the facts and circumstances of the case and submissions of learned counsel for the parties, in the event of arrest or surrender before the court below within six weeks from today, the petitioners no. 1, 2, 3, 5, 6, 7, 8 and 9 be released on bail upon furnishing bail bonds of Rs.10,000/- (ten thousand) each with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of the concerned Judicial Magistrate, 1st Class, Raxaul, East Champaran at Motihari in Chhauradano P.S. Case No. 125 of 2015, subject to the conditions laid down in Section 438(2) of the Code of Criminal Procedure, 1973.
